About this listen

Bloomsbury presents A Bear Belongs by Catherine Barr, read by Nano Nagle.

Southeast Asian rainforests are home to the smallest and one of the rarest and most endangered bears of all: the sun bear. Sun bears belong deep in the forest, far from humans. But this is the true story of three little bears who were taken from their wild home . . .

Meet Tan-Tan "the tiny one," Kitud "the quiet one," and Boboi "the big brother." Follow them from their heartbreaking beginnings as little cubs stolen from their natural habitat, through their heroic rescue by conservationists, until at last they are released back into the wild Bornean rainforest where they belong.

Featuring insightful fact files about the amazing flora and fauna of the rainforest and the importance of this incredible ecosystem, alongside inspiring information about how to protect endangered sun bears, this book is sure to captivate hearts and minds.
